Academy City – Hound Dog Unit Headquarters 

Dressed in casual clothing, George strode toward the deepest section of the headquarters—the archive room. Under the influence of his electromagnetic abilities, all nearby surveillance cameras had been rendered useless. 

Although his body in this world was female, it didn't feel all that different from a male body due to his impoverished circumstances. At the very least, he didn't have to deal with any discomfort, like an overly heavy chest causing his posture to shift forward. 

Bathing and other hygiene matters could be easily handled with magic, eliminating any awkwardness. 

As for clothing, there was no way he was going to dress like Misaka Mikoto or the Misaka clones, wandering around all day in a short skirt. Instead, he opted for men's casual wear, complete with a hat to further obscure his appearance. 

At a glance, it wasn't easy to determine his gender. 

"Confundus!" 

Casting a Confundus Charm on the guards stationed outside the archive room, George walked in openly and began flipping through the documents inside with practiced ease. 

Thanks to his efforts in the Harry Potter world, he had already mastered wandless, silent casting for simpler spells. However, more advanced magic still required hand gestures to properly channel. 

Still, with his various counterparts working hard in different worlds, it wouldn't be long before he could cast all spells silently and without a wand. 

"So magic really does exist in this world!" 

George's eyes lit up as he skimmed through the documents detailing magic. 

Due to concerns about hackers and ability users like Misaka Mikoto, who could infiltrate computers with their powers, organizations like the Hound Dog Unit kept physical copies of crucial research and intelligence in their archives. 

After learning about this, George frequently infiltrated the archives to study classified materials. 

Today, he had finally found a lead on magic. 

According to the documents, this world housed multiple magical factions, with the most powerful being the three major branches of the Christian Church: 

- Roman Catholic Church 

- Anglican Church (English Puritanism) 

- Russian Orthodox Church 

Beyond these, there were also numerous independent magical organizations and freelance magicians. 

However, the report didn't provide extensive details about these magical groups. It merely noted that they regarded magic as a type of supernatural ability, believing magicians to be a variant of esper. 

Additionally, Academy City didn't seem particularly welcoming toward magicians. 

Likewise, the magical factions themselves weren't exactly united. Internal conflicts between them were intense. 

"So most magicians are affiliated with the church? That makes things easier." 

With these clues in hand, George saw a simple path forward. If he captured a high-ranking magician from one of the churches and extracted their memories, he could uncover the true nature of magic in this world. 

Closing the file, George exited the archive room. He had already reviewed most of the research stored there, including extensive studies on esper abilities, which had proven useful in increasing his own power level. 

"Subject #9981, it's time for your ability enhancement experiment." 

Just as he left the archives, he ran into a man in a white lab coat—Kihara Amata. 

Kihara narrowed his eyes at George, suspicion evident on his face. 

No matter where George went, he always used his abilities to disrupt surveillance, claiming he disliked being monitored. As a result, Kihara had no idea what he was actually up to whenever he wandered around the base. 

Lately, every time Kihara Amata went looking for George, he always found him near the archive room. 

Although the guards swore they had never seen George there, Kihara couldn't shake the feeling that something was off. 

"No problem." 

George didn't resist and obediently followed Kihara Amata to the laboratory. 

Kihara's ability enhancement experiments did, in fact, help accelerate the growth of George's esper level. However, Kihara wasn't just interested in strengthening his abilities—he also wanted to study his body and uncover the cause of his mutation. 

Of course, for someone like George, who possessed both the Legilimency Charm and psychic abilities, Kihara's little schemes were completely transparent. 

"Astral Projection!" 

The moment they entered the lab, George cast the Imperius Curse on Kihara Amata from behind, then skillfully used his electromagnetic abilities to disable the surveillance equipment. 

The Imperius Curse worked exceptionally well on ordinary humans, and with the added power of his psychic abilities, George could flawlessly control Kihara every time he underwent an experiment. 

"Begin, but don't extract my blood. Also, alter some of the data." 

Under George's command, Kihara obediently followed his instructions and began the enhancement experiment. 

Once the experiment was completed, Kihara reviewed the results and reported: 

"According to the data, if development continues at this rate, you'll reach Level 5 in about two months." 

"Good. Change that result to two years." 

George got up from the experimental machine and placed a small vial of blood into the system. 

By altering the report, he could lower the suspicions of the man pulling the strings behind Kihara—Aleister Crowley. 

As for the blood sample, it wasn't his own but had been drawn from another Misaka clone. Every time the experiment required a sample, he swapped in blood from the clones instead of his own. 

There was no way he would allow Academy City to obtain and study his real blood. 

Having secretly sifted through Kihara's memories, George had already gained extensive knowledge about Academy City. 

Most importantly, he had uncovered crucial intelligence regarding Aleister Crowley. 

At first, he assumed that Academy City's highest authorities were the Board of Directors, the elite figures responsible for the city's creation and the development of espers. 

But in reality, the true ruler of Academy City wasn't the Board of Directors. There was only one real leader—one true creator of Academy City—Aleister Crowley. 

Both Kihara Amata and the Hound Dog Unit operated directly under Aleister's command. 

From Kihara's memories, Aleister appeared to be omniscient, controlling every aspect of Academy City with near-absolute precision, though he remained suspended upside-down inside a life-support chamber in District 7. 

George had every reason to suspect that the Misaka clone experiments and the miniature surveillance robots constantly monitoring him all stemmed from Aleister's influence. 

The man had built an entire futuristic metropolis, developed countless espers, and possessed unfathomable power. There was no doubt—Aleister Crowley was far from ordinary. His strength was beyond comprehension. 

Because of this, George chose not to act recklessly. Instead, he opted to lay low, carefully feeding false information through Kihara Amata. 

During his daily activities, he would instinctively use his magnetic field to repel any miniature surveillance drones that got too close—or simply cast a Disillusionment Charm to remain unseen. 

"Obliviate! False Memory Implant!" 

Using a Memory Charm, George erased Kihara's recent memories and seamlessly replaced them with fabricated ones. Only then did he lift the Imperius Curse. 

When Kihara regained his senses, he didn't notice anything amiss. 

Satisfied, he dismissed George and proceeded with the next round of tests using what he believed to be George's blood sample. 

Meanwhile, George quietly left the Hound Dog Unit Headquarters.
